Leonard W. Reeves is a scholar working on Spectroscopy, Electronic, Optical and Magnetic Materials and Atomic and Molecular Physics, and Optics. According to data from OpenAlex, Leonard W. Reeves has authored 35 papers receiving a total of 573 indexed citations (citations by other indexed papers that have themselves been cited), including 21 papers in Spectroscopy, 14 papers in Electronic, Optical and Magnetic Materials and 12 papers in Atomic and Molecular Physics, and Optics. Recurrent topics in Leonard W. Reeves’s work include Molecular spectroscopy and chirality (14 papers), Liquid Crystal Research Advancements (13 papers) and Surfactants and Colloidal Systems (10 papers). Leonard W. Reeves is often cited by papers focused on Molecular spectroscopy and chirality (14 papers), Liquid Crystal Research Advancements (13 papers) and Surfactants and Colloidal Systems (10 papers). Leonard W. Reeves collaborates with scholars based in Canada, Brazil and Slovenia. Leonard W. Reeves's co-authors include Bruce J. Forrest, Fred Y. Fujiwara, Alan Tracey, G. Lahajnar and S. Žumer and has published in prestigious journals such as Chemical Reviews, Journal of the American Chemical Society and The Journal of Chemical Physics.
